INFO:2025-12-29T16:45:13Z:root:pulling... From github.com:llvm/llvm-project * branch main -> FETCH_HEAD 0347c30f6878..4c0360753e77 main -> origin/main Switched to branch 'main' Your branch is behind 'origin/main' by 2 commits, and can be fast-forwarded. (use "git pull" to update your local branch) HEAD is now at 4c0360753e77 [libc++][ranges] Applied `[[nodiscard]]` to `single_view` (#173709) INFO:2025-12-29T16:45:16Z:root:syncing... Deleted branch merge (was 2ac730d33d5b). Switched to a new branch 'merge' branch 'merge' set up to track 'origin/main'. [merge 4d34d7fff056] [gn build] Port 05a34dde7008 1 file changed, 1 insertion(+) [gn build] Port 05a34dde7008 -- https://github.com/llvm/llvm-project/commit/05a34dde7008 INFO:2025-12-29T16:45:17Z:root:building ninja: Entering directory `out/gn' [0/1] Regenerating ninja files [1/1354] COPY ../../libcxx/include/__ranges/repeat_view.h include/c++/v1/__ranges/repeat_view.h [2/1354] COPY ../../libcxx/include/__ranges/single_view.h include/c++/v1/__ranges/single_view.h [3/1354] ACTION //llvm/tools/llvm-libtool-darwin:Opts(//llvm/utils/gn/build/toolchain:unix) [4/1354] ACTION //llvm/tools/dsymutil:Options(//llvm/utils/gn/build/toolchain:unix) [5/1354] CXX obj/BUILD_DIR/gen/llvm/tools/llvm-ar/llvm-ar.llvm_ar-driver.o [6/1354] CXX obj/BUILD_DIR/gen/llvm/tools/llvm-libtool-darwin/llvm-libtool-darwin.llvm_libtool_darwin-driver.o [7/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.Vectorize.o [8/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.Utils.o [9/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.NameAnonGlobals.o [10/1354] CXX obj/llvm/tools/llvm-debuginfod-find/llvm-debuginfod-find.llvm-debuginfod-find.o [11/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.UnifyFunctionExitNodes.o [12/1354] CXX obj/llvm/tools/lli/ChildTarget/lli-child-target.ChildTarget.o [13/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SanitizerStats.o [14/1354] CXX obj/llvm/tools/dsymutil/dsymutil.Reproducer.o [15/1354] CXX obj/llvm/tools/bugpoint/bugpoint.FindBugs.o [16/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SizeOpts.o [17/1354] CXX obj/BUILD_DIR/gen/llvm/tools/dsymutil/dsymutil.dsymutil-driver.o [18/1354] ACTION //llvm/tools/llvm-cgdata:Opts(//llvm/utils/gn/build/toolchain:unix) [19/1354] ACTION //llvm/tools/llvm-cas:Options(//llvm/utils/gn/build/toolchain:unix) [20/1354] CXX obj/llvm/tools/bugpoint/bugpoint.ExecutionDriver.o [21/1354] LINK ./bin/llvm-bcanalyzer [22/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SymbolRewriter.o [23/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.StripGCRelocates.o [24/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SampleProfileInference.o [25/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.StripNonLineTableDebugInfo.o [26/1354] ACTION //llvm/tools/llvm-cvtres:Opts(//llvm/utils/gn/build/toolchain:unix) [27/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.UnifyLoopExits.o [28/1354] CXX obj/llvm/tools/dsymutil/dsymutil.RelocationMap.o [29/1354] ACTION //llvm/tools/llvm-cxxfilt:Opts(//llvm/utils/gn/build/toolchain:unix) [30/1354] LINK ./bin/llvm-ctxprof-util [31/1354] CXX obj/llvm/tools/bugpoint/bugpoint.BugDriver.o [32/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SampleProfileLoaderBaseUtil.o [33/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SplitModule.o [34/1354] CXX obj/llvm/unittests/ExecutionEngine/MCJIT/MCJITTests.MCJITCAPITest.o [35/1354] LINK ./bin/llvm-cov [36/1354] CXX obj/BUILD_DIR/gen/llvm/tools/llvm-cgdata/llvm-cgdata.llvm_cgdata-driver.o [37/1354] LINK ./bin/llvm-dis [38/1354] CXX obj/llvm/tools/llvm-as/llvm-as.llvm-as.o [39/1354] CXX obj/llvm/tools/dsymutil/dsymutil.BinaryHolder.o [40/1354] CXX obj/llvm/tools/bugpoint/bugpoint.ExtractFunction.o [41/1354] LINK ./bin/llvm-debuginfod [42/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.VNCoercion.o [43/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.RelLookupTableConverter.o [44/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.ProfileVerify.o [45/1354] CXX obj/llvm/tools/llvm-ar/llvm-ar.llvm-ar.o [46/1354] LINK ./bin/llvm-diff [47/1354] ACTION //llvm/tools/llvm-dwp:Opts(//llvm/utils/gn/build/toolchain:unix) [48/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SplitModuleByCategory.o [49/1354] CXX obj/llvm/tools/bugpoint/bugpoint.OptimizerDriver.o [50/1354] ACTION //llvm/tools/llvm-ifs:Opts(//llvm/utils/gn/build/toolchain:unix) [51/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SSAUpdaterBulk.o [52/1354] CXX obj/llvm/tools/llvm-c-test/llvm-c-test.echo.o [53/1354] CXX obj/llvm/tools/dsymutil/dsymutil.SwiftModule.o [54/1354] CXX obj/llvm/unittests/CodeGen/GlobalISel/GlobalISelTests.GIMatchTableExecutorTest.o [55/1354] CXX obj/BUILD_DIR/gen/llvm/tools/llvm-cxxfilt/llvm-cxxfilt.llvm_cxxfilt-driver.o [56/1354] CXX obj/llvm/tools/dsymutil/dsymutil.DebugMap.o [57/1354] ACTION //llvm/tools/llvm-gsymutil:Opts(//llvm/utils/gn/build/toolchain:unix) [58/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SSAUpdater.o [59/1354] CXX obj/llvm/lib/Transforms/Vectorize/SandboxVectorizer/Vectorize.Interval.o [60/1354] CXX obj/BUILD_DIR/gen/llvm/tools/llvm-dwp/llvm-dwp.llvm_dwp-driver.o [61/1354] CXX obj/BUILD_DIR/gen/llvm/tools/llvm-debuginfod-find/llvm-debuginfod-find.llvm_debuginfod_find-driver.o [62/1354] CXX obj/llvm/lib/Target/X86/GISel/LLVMX86CodeGen.X86PreLegalizerCombiner.o FAILED: obj/llvm/lib/Target/X86/GISel/LLVMX86CodeGen.X86PreLegalizerCombiner.o ../../../chrome/src/third_party/llvm-build/Release+Asserts/bin/clang++ -MMD -MF obj/llvm/lib/Target/X86/GISel/LLVMX86CodeGen.X86PreLegalizerCombiner.o.d -o obj/llvm/lib/Target/X86/GISel/LLVMX86CodeGen.X86PreLegalizerCombiner.o -c ../../llvm/lib/Target/X86/GISel/X86PreLegalizerCombiner.cpp -I../../llvm/lib/Target/X86 -I../../llvm/include -Igen/llvm/include -Igen/llvm/lib/Target/X86 -I. -Igen/llvm/lib/Target/X86/MCTargetDesc -Igen/llvm/include/llvm/Analysis -Igen/llvm/include/llvm/IR -O3 -fdiagnostics-color -Wall -Wextra -Wno-unused-parameter -Wdelete-non-virtual-dtor -Wstring-conversion -no-canonical-prefixes -Werror=date-time -fdebug-compilation-dir=. --sysroot=../../sysroot -Wpoison-system-directories -fPIC -Wcovered-switch-default -std=c++17 -fvisibility-inlines-hidden -fno-exceptions -fno-rtti ../../llvm/lib/Target/X86/GISel/X86PreLegalizerCombiner.cpp:33:10: fatal error: 'X86GenPreLegalizeGICombiner.inc' file not found 33 | #include "X86GenPreLegalizeGICombiner.inc" | 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 1 error generated. [63/1354] CXX obj/llvm/tools/bugpoint/bugpoint.ToolRunner.o [64/1354] CXX obj/BUILD_DIR/gen/llvm/tools/llvm-gsymutil/llvm-gsymutil.llvm_gsymutil-driver.o [65/1354] LINK ./bin/llvm-debuginfod-find [66/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.ValueMapper.o [67/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.MoveAutoInit.o [68/1354] CXX obj/llvm/tools/llvm-cxxfilt/llvm-cxxfilt.llvm-cxxfilt.o [69/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.PredicateInfo.o [70/1354] CXX obj/llvm/lib/Transforms/Vectorize/SandboxVectorizer/Vectorize.InstrMaps.o [71/1354] CXX obj/llvm/tools/llvm-ifs/llvm-ifs.ErrorCollector.o [72/1354] CXX obj/llvm/tools/llvm-cas/llvm-cas.llvm-cas.o [73/1354] CXX obj/llvm/tools/bugpoint/bugpoint.Miscompilation.o [74/1354] CXX obj/llvm/tools/llvm-cxxmap/llvm-cxxmap.llvm-cxxmap.o [75/1354] CXX obj/llvm/tools/llvm-dwarfdump/llvm-dwarfdump.SectionSizes.o [76/1354] CXX obj/llvm/tools/llvm-cvtres/llvm-cvtres.llvm-cvtres.o [77/1354] CXX obj/llvm/tools/llvm-jitlink/llvm-jitlink.llvm-jitlink-elf.o [78/1354] CXX obj/llvm/tools/llvm-jitlink/llvm-jitlink.llvm-jitlink-macho.o [79/1354] CXX obj/llvm/tools/dsymutil/dsymutil.MachODebugMapParser.o [80/1354] CXX obj/llvm/lib/Transforms/Vectorize/SandboxVectorizer/Vectorize.DependencyGraph.o [81/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.LoopIdiomVectorize.o [82/1354] CXX obj/llvm/tools/llvm-cat/llvm-cat.llvm-cat.o [83/1354] CXX obj/llvm/tools/llvm-cgdata/llvm-cgdata.llvm-cgdata.o [84/1354] CXX obj/llvm/lib/Transforms/Vectorize/SandboxVectorizer/Vectorize.Legality.o [85/1354] CXX obj/llvm/tools/llvm-cfi-verify/llvm-cfi-verify.llvm-cfi-verify.o [86/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SimplifyIndVar.o [87/1354] CXX obj/llvm/tools/llvm-ifs/llvm-ifs.llvm-ifs.o [88/1354] CXX obj/llvm/tools/llc/llc.llc.o [89/1354] CXX obj/llvm/tools/llvm-cxxdump/llvm-cxxdump.llvm-cxxdump.o [90/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.VPlanSLP.o [91/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.PromoteMemoryToRegister.o [92/1354] ACTION //llvm/tools/llvm-exegesis/lib/X86:X86GenExegesis(//llvm/utils/gn/build/toolchain:unix) [93/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SimplifyLibCalls.o [94/1354] CXX obj/llvm/tools/llvm-debuginfo-analyzer/llvm-debuginfo-analyzer.llvm-debuginfo-analyzer.o [95/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.VPlanUtils.o [96/1354] CXX obj/llvm/tools/bugpoint/bugpoint.bugpoint.o [97/1354] CXX obj/llvm/tools/llvm-dwarfdump/llvm-dwarfdump.Statistics.o [98/1354] CXX obj/llvm/tools/dsymutil/dsymutil.MachOUtils.o [99/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.ScalarEvolutionExpander.o [100/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.VPlanVerifier.o [101/1354] CXX obj/llvm/tools/llvm-dwp/llvm-dwp.llvm-dwp.o [102/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.LoopVectorizationLegality.o [103/1354] ACTION //llvm/tools/llvm-exegesis/lib/RISCV:RISCVGenExegesis(//llvm/utils/gn/build/toolchain:unix) [104/1354] CXX obj/llvm/tools/bugpoint/bugpoint.CrashDebugger.o [105/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SCCPSolver.o [106/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.VPlanUnroll.o [107/1354] CXX obj/llvm/tools/llvm-jitlink/llvm-jitlink.llvm-jitlink-coff.o [108/1354] CXX obj/llvm/tools/llvm-dwarfdump/llvm-dwarfdump.llvm-dwarfdump.o [109/1354] CXX obj/llvm/tools/llvm-gsymutil/llvm-gsymutil.llvm-gsymutil.o [110/1354] CXX obj/llvm/tools/llvm-libtool-darwin/llvm-libtool-darwin.llvm-libtool-darwin.o [111/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.LoadStoreVectorizer.o [112/1354] CXX obj/llvm/tools/llc/llc.NewPMDriver.o [113/1354] CXX obj/llvm/tools/dsymutil/dsymutil.dsymutil.o [114/1354] CXX obj/llvm/tools/llvm-dwarfutil/llvm-dwarfutil.DebugInfoLinker.o [115/1354] CXX obj/llvm/tools/llvm-extract/llvm-extract.llvm-extract.o [116/1354] CXX obj/llvm/tools/dsymutil/dsymutil.DwarfLinkerForBinary.o [117/1354] CXX obj/llvm/tools/llvm-ir2vec/llvm-ir2vec.llvm-ir2vec.o [118/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.VPlanRecipes.o [119/1354] CXX obj/llvm/tools/llvm-exegesis/lib/PowerPC/PowerPC.Target.o [120/1354] CXX obj/llvm/tools/llvm-exegesis/lib/Mips/Mips.Target.o [121/1354] CXX obj/llvm/tools/llvm-exegesis/lib/AArch64/AArch64.Target.o [122/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.VectorCombine.o [123/1354] CXX obj/llvm/tools/lli/lli.lli.o [124/1354] CXX obj/llvm/lib/Transforms/Utils/Utils.SimplifyCFG.o [125/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.VPlanTransforms.o [126/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.LoopVectorize.o [127/1354] CXX obj/llvm/lib/Transforms/Vectorize/Vectorize.SLPVectorizer.o ninja: build stopped: subcommand failed. Command '['ninja', '-C', 'out/gn']' returned non-zero exit status 1.